Weather Playbook time! Let's talk about something super cool - atmospheric instability. Think of the atmosphere like a football field where different air masses are competing. When warm, moist air gets pushed up quickly, it creates unstable conditions - kind of like a quarterback getting sacked! This instability is what creates those thundering, lightning-packed plays we call severe storms.
